Trebisacce is a town and comune in the province of Cosenza in the Calabria region of southern Italy. It is 92 km from the provincial capital of Cosenza, overlooking the Ionian Sea.
==Twin towns — sister cities== Trebisacce is twinned with: Mazara del Vallo, Italy
